If I may conjecture, it seems like the OP is a completionist. Now, this isn't a bad thing by any means.
Well, that's not true. It's a bad thing when it comes to undirectional sandbox games.
Now, a completionist is somebody who strives to "do everything" in a game. (finish it 100%) again, not a bad thing. Before acheivements/stats, there was no way to really rate "completion" so the game was a carefree environment where they could throw off the shackles of their OCD completionism.
however, with the addition of acheivements and stats... that changes. Now there are values they can toggle by performing certain tasks. And by god they are going to toggle every damn last one of them. And now there are numbers relating to various other actions! We must grind these for no reason- that's definitely obsessive. I mean, nobody makes an effort to increase how much disk space they use. it's just informational. That's the way I think of the stats.
